What this inspection record means

OSHA opens inspections for many reasons: routine scheduling under a national or local emphasis program, an employee complaint or referral, or a follow-up after a reported injury. Opening or conducting an inspection is not itself an allegation or a finding that this employer broke any rule; any findings appear as the citations listed below, and citations can be contested, reduced, or withdrawn.

29 CFR 1926.453(b)(2)(iv): Employee(s) were not standing firmly on the floor of the basket, were sitting or climbing on the edge of the basket, or were using planks, ladders, or other devices for a work position.     On or about 27 January 2020, one worker was performing painting preparation activities using a Genie Boom Lift Model S-80X on the second floor balcony of a multi-family new residential under construction. While performing these painting preparation activities the worker climbed the mid rail of the genie boom lift. The workers operating the boom lift were not trained on the proper use of it before it was released for their use. Thus, exposing the workers to a fall hazard.

29 CFR 1926.501(b)(13): Each employee(s) engaged in residential construction activities 6 feet (1.8 m) or more above lower levels were not protected by guardrail systems, safety net system, or personal fall arrest system, nor were employee(s) provided with an alternative fall protection measure under another provision of paragraph 1926.501(b).    On or about 27 January 2020, two workers were performing painting preparation activities on a multi-family residence under construction without the use of fall protection, exposing them to a fall hazard of approximately 12 feet 4 inches to the ground.

29 CFR 1926.503(a)(2): The employer did not assure that each employee exposed to fall hazards was trained by a competent person qualified in the areas specified in 29 CFR 1926.503 (a)(2)(i) through (viii).       On or about 27 January 2020, two workers were performing painting preparation activities on a multi-family residence under construction without the use of fall protection and which did not had fall protection training, thus exposing the work to a fall hazard of approximately 12 feet 4 inches to the ground.
